[QUOTE="Tob, post: 16486875, member: 83412"] Just an example, using Ford's ETIS site I took a look at my own car and the numerous control modules. My '20 GT500 reached the end of the assembly line on 11/13/19. This is denoted on the screenshot below. So all the modules became fired up and operational on that day. I highlighted the Telematics module in yellow and note that it decided to hook up to the mothership on its own on 3/8/20. [ATTACH=full]1661788[/ATTACH] The lines highlighted in red were because Ford now has updated calibrations available for the engine and transmission control modules and I did that for reference to the calibration numbers.
